Default What will this do for me....

Going to apologise now - in advance - for any typing mistakes because I'm not overly "fluent" in "engine talk" LOL.

Basically I have a MY99 with full de-cat, walbro fuel pump, VF28, FMI and dump valve.

car recently went into garage for other faults and it was discovered that the coolant was pressurising and the head gasket was suggested

The following is a description of what we found - at a very nice price.

Version 6 sti heads (off P1), ported & polished, 10mil spark plug conversion, piper BP270 cams, neomonic valves, angled valved seats and sti version 4 low compression gaskets - oh and samco induction hose thrown in as well.

All sounded pretty good - but since then its been found that the coolant isn't pressurising - it was due to hoses being put back incorrectly from previous repairs.

So now we're toying with the idea of having the above as a mod? My question is..... what will it do for me? I'm currently running just over 310 break and am minded to upgrade my injectors and my turbo in the not too distant future. I'm aware that a tweak on my map will be required - but was wondering what the increase in break would be?
